The detailed evaluation of a patient for liver transplant candidacy involves health care professionals from various disciplines to ensure that liver transplantation is optimal for patient morbidity and mortality from the medical and psychosocial perspective. The national liver allocation policy is complex and should be updated periodically based on continual assessment of outcomes that result from current policies. Streamlining of policies and procedures and implementing appropriate documentation across all transplant centers is required and regulated by National agencies such as OPTN/UNOS and CMS. This ensures safe and appropriate organ allocation and the delivery of high-quality transplant services.
